In this 15 minute interview, Andrew Selley(Founder & CEO of FOR SA) speaks to Gareth Burley of Kingfisher FM about the escalating threat to religious freedom in South Africa. Andrew explains how he got involved in religious freedom issues, and why he felt led to start Freedom of Religion South Africa.He mentions some of the cases that FOR SA has been involved in, and some of the important cases that are pending before government commissions and SA court at the moment. Freedom of Religion South Africa (FOR SA) is dedicated to protecting and preserving the freedoms and rights that the South African Constitution has granted to the faith community.
